Bactrazine: An Overview of its Identity and Pharmacological Class

Bactrazine is the commercial designation for the pharmaceutical agent Sulfadiazine Silver, which is classified as a Topical Antibacterial and Anti-Infective agent. This medicinal entity functions exclusively at the site of application (Topical Route of Administration) to combat contamination and infection.

Chemically, Sulfadiazine Silver is a synthetic salt derived from the sulfonamide class of drugs, combined with elemental silver. This unique chemical structure is clinically recognized for its effectiveness against a broad range of pathogens and is the reason it falls under the broader Sulfonamide derivative pharmacological group. The active ingredient, Sulfadiazine Silver (INN), is also available under other trade names such as Silvadene.


Composition, Form, and Origin: What is Bactrazine Made of?

The active ingredient in Bactrazine is Sulfadiazine Silver, and it is primarily supplied as a Topical Cream. This product is a single-entity agent, relying solely on the Sulfadiazine Silver molecule for therapeutic effect. The Topical Cream is typically an oil-in-water emulsion that acts as the vehicle, ensuring the active salt is delivered evenly and continuously to the affected area.

Sulfadiazine Silver is included on the Model List of Essential Medicines. This inclusion confirms its essential role in providing localized anti-infective treatment where contamination is a significant concern.

What side effects are possible with Bactrazine?

Possible Side Effects and Safety Information

The safety profile for Bactrazine (Sulfadiazine Silver) is structured according to official regulatory documentation, distinguishing between common local reactions and rare, systemic safety concerns.


Documented Adverse Reactions

The most frequently observed adverse reactions, classified as Common in regulatory labeling, are typically limited to the application site. These include a burning sensation, pain, and localized itching.

Adverse effects are categorized by the systems they affect. Skin and Subcutaneous Tissue Disorders cover local reactions. Rare systemic effects, which occur only when there is extensive absorption of the sulfonamide component, may involve the Blood and Lymphatic System Disorders (such as leukopenia) and Renal and Urinary Disorders.


Serious Safety Considerations

Although rare, official labeling documents the possibility of serious systemic reactions historically linked to sulfonamides, particularly with extensive or prolonged use. These include Stevens-Johnson syndrome (SJS) and Toxic Epidermal Necrolysis (TEN), which are severe cutaneous reactions. Leukopenia, a reduction in white blood cell count, is noted to typically manifest two to four days after the initiation of therapy.


Population-Specific Restrictions

Use of Sulfadiazine Silver is contraindicated in infants under two months old and in late-stage pregnancy due to the theoretical risk of kernicterus. Furthermore, the medicine is restricted for individuals with a known history of sulfonamide hypersensitivity and requires caution in patients with Glucose-6-Phosphate Dehydrogenase (G6PD) deficiency.

Eligibility and Restrictions for Use

Who Can and Cannot Use Bactrazine (Sulfadiazine Silver)

Bactrazine (Sulfadiazine Silver) eligibility is defined by strict regulatory guidelines focused on population risks, primarily related to the sulfonamide component. Use is contraindicated (must not be used) in several critical groups due to the risk of kernicterus (bilirubin-induced brain damage) or hypersensitivity reactions.

Contraindications and Restrictions

Population Group Eligibility Status Regulatory Basis
Newborns & Infants under 2 months Contraindicated Risk of kernicterus
Pregnant women at term (3rd trimester) Contraindicated Risk of kernicterus in neonate
Known Sulfonamide Allergy Contraindicated Risk of hypersensitivity

Conditional and Restricted Use

Use is restricted or requires caution in patients with certain conditions, reflecting the risk of systemic absorption and accumulation. The medicine should be used with caution in individuals with impaired hepatic (liver) function or impaired renal (kidney) function. Caution is also warranted for patients with Glucose-6-Phosphate Dehydrogenase (G6PD) deficiency due to the risk of hemolysis. While generally allowed in children over 2 months of age and adults, use during the first two trimesters of pregnancy is permitted only if the benefit outweighs the risk.

What should I know about interactions with other medicines?

Bactrazine Interactions with other medicines and products

The interaction profile for Sulfadiazine Silver Topical Cream (Bactrazine) is defined by specific chemical incompatibilities at the application site and caution regarding potential systemic absorption risk. This information is derived exclusively from official government regulatory documents.


Category Official Regulatory Classification
Documented Interactions Topical Proteolytic Enzymes; Cimetidine
Interaction Severity Use-With-Caution; Clinically Significant
Regulatory Basis FDA / EMA-aligned prescribing information

Official Interaction Statements:

  • Topical Proteolytic Enzymes: Co-administration with enzymatic debriding agents is documented to result in the chemical inactivation of the enzyme by the silver component. This inactivation leads to a reduction in the debriding agent's therapeutic activity, and joint use is officially not appropriate.
  • Cimetidine: Concomitant use has been formally associated with an increased incidence of leukopenia. This systemic risk is related to the potential for absorbed sulfadiazine to affect hematologic function when combined with Cimetidine.

Population-Specific Caution:

  • In patients with Hepatic or Renal Impairment, official documentation notes a risk of systemic sulfadiazine accumulation. This is due to a decreased rate of drug clearance, which can lead to a heightened potential for sulfonamide-related adverse events.

Connection to the overall interaction profile:

Regulatory documents define the product’s interaction structure primarily through a unique chemical incompatibility at the application site and a pharmacodynamic risk related to the systemic exposure of the sulfonamide component. These factors impose specific constraints on co-administration with other topical agents and systemic medications.

Mechanism of Action

How Bactrazine Works: The Mechanism of Action

Bactrazine (Sulfadiazine Silver) operates via a sustained, dual-action mechanism that combines both structural damage and metabolic interference to reduce microbial proliferation.


Direct Cellular Disruption by the Silver Ion

The core of the mechanism involves the rapid, non-specific action of the silver ion ( Ag^+), which targets multiple vital structures within the microbe. The Ag^+ ion binds chemically to thiol groups on the bacterial cell membrane, causing structural failure and leakage. Once inside the cell, Ag^+ rapidly inactivates key respiratory enzymes required for ATP (energy) synthesis and damages the DNA and RNA. This multi-point molecular assault results in the direct destruction of microbial cells (biocidal action).


Metabolic Pathway Blockade by Sulfadiazine

The second, complementary mechanism involves the Sulfadiazine component, which acts as a structural mimic of PABA. Sulfadiazine competitively inhibits the bacterial enzyme Dihydropteroate Synthetase, a critical step in the microbe's internal synthesis of folic acid. By blocking this essential pathway, the Sulfadiazine component deprives the microbe of the necessary precursors for building new DNA and RNA, halting its ability to grow and multiply (bacteriostatic action).


Sustained Synergy and Mechanistic Constraints

The unique salt structure ensures the continuous, simultaneous release of both components, providing coordinated activity against the microbe’s structure and metabolism. This synergy results in a localized physiological effect that is sustained. However, the mechanism is limited by the local environment, as the active Ag^+ can be bound and deactivated by chloride ions and proteins found in wound exudate, resulting in a reduced concentration of the bioavailable ion.

Dosage and Administration Information

Bactrazine (Silver Sulfadiazine 1% Cream) is a topical medication used exclusively on the surface of the skin, following strict administration principles.

Administration and Dosage Regimen

The medicine is applied as a Topical Cream 1% for external use. The application procedure requires that the affected area be cleansed and debrided prior to the initial application to remove debris. The cream is then applied under sterile conditions, typically using a sterile gloved hand.

The standard regimen requires applying the cream to a thickness of approximately 1/16 inch (or 1 to 3 mm) to ensure the area is covered. Application is performed once to twice daily. It is an official requirement that the affected surface must remain continuously covered with the cream at all times. If the cream is removed by patient activity, such as after hydrotherapy, it must be reapplied immediately.

Duration and Specific Use Rules

The duration of treatment is not fixed but should continue until satisfactory healing has occurred or until the wound site is ready for further intervention, such as grafting. Treatment should not be withdrawn while there remains a possibility of infection, unless an adverse reaction occurs.

Bactrazine use is not recommended in premature infants or in newborn infants during the first 2 months of life.

Recent Clinical Evidence

Research Evidence / Overview of Studies for Bactrazine (Sulfadiazine Silver)

The research evidence for Bactrazine, whose active ingredient is Sulfadiazine Silver, primarily focuses on its role as a topical agent studied for use in managing contamination and time to wound closure. Findings describe group patterns and are drawn from studies conducted by scientific and regulatory bodies, providing context but not individual predictions.


Evidence for Use in Managing Burn Wounds

Bactrazine was studied for its use in managing contamination and time to wound closure for patients with partial and full-thickness burn injuries. The evidence base for this application features Randomized Controlled Trials (RCTs) and comprehensive Systematic Reviews that combine data from multiple studies. Research has explored outcomes related to infection control and wound healing using study designs that included comparisons to various topical agents and dressings.

Studies monitored specific measurements such as the time required for the wound to fully close (epithelialization) and levels of bacterial colonization. Rates of developing a clinical wound infection were also examined. Findings describe patterns observed in the studies, which often indicated the cream’s pattern of broad anti-infective effects. Some trials described patterns of bacterial load reduction at the application site, a finding that contributes to the broader evidence landscape concerning its topical use.


Research Studies in Other Chronic Skin Wounds

Bactrazine was evaluated in research exploring outcomes for chronic wounds, such as diabetic foot ulcers and pressure sores. This research primarily relies on smaller comparative clinical trials and observational settings. Studies explored the cream’s ability to examine microbial load and contamination in these complex wounds. Findings indicate that research monitored patterns related to microbial load management in these environments. The evidence base for these specific indications is generally considered limited, and the evidence quality varies across studies.


Research Gaps and Areas of Uncertainty

Long-term effects are not fully established. The majority of clinical trials utilized short-term to intermediate follow-up periods, typically concluding once the wound reached complete epithelialization. There is limited information for long-term outcomes such as the final quality of scar tissue. Furthermore, comparative evidence is lacking for some comparisons, meaning the relative advantage in terms of accelerating wound healing compared to all alternatives is not fully established. Research does not determine whether an individual will respond similarly.

Frequently Asked Questions (FAQ)

Common questions about Bactrazine (FAQ)


Q: Does Bactrazine need to build up in my system to work?

The cream is a topical agent, meaning it works directly at the site of application on the skin. Official information indicates that the drug’s primary antimicrobial effect is localized, targeting bacterial structures. Therefore, its primary activity is understood not to rely on a systemic "build-up" throughout the body, though a small amount may be absorbed.


Q: Is Bactrazine known to cause long-term side effects?

Studies reviewed for regulatory approval primarily utilized short-term to intermediate follow-up periods. The available official research findings indicate that data is limited regarding certain long-term outcomes, such as the final quality of scar tissue.


Q: Can older adults safely use Bactrazine?

Official documents report that clinical studies did not identify overall differences in effectiveness or safety between older adult patients and younger patients. However, as with many medications, greater sensitivity in some older individuals is a possibility that cannot be completely ruled out.


Q: Is there a generic version of Bactrazine?

Bactrazine is a brand name for the drug. The active ingredient is known officially as silver sulfadiazine, which is the generic name for the compound. This generic name is also available under other trade names.


Q: Can Bactrazine be used by people who have a history of allergies?

Official prescribing information lists a strict contraindication for individuals with a known hypersensitivity (severe allergic reaction) to silver sulfadiazine or any medication in the sulfa drug class. Regarding general allergies, it is consistent with good medical practice to inform the healthcare provider of any allergy history.


Q: What does 'contraindicated' mean for Bactrazine?

The term contraindicated means that the medication must not be used in specific situations or patient groups because the risks are deemed to outweigh any potential benefits. For Bactrazine, this applies to newborns under two months old and women who are at term in their pregnancy, based on specific safety and risk concerns noted in regulatory documents.


Q: Why do some people say Bactrazine makes them feel tired?

Official product information indicates that unusual tiredness or weakness is a possible symptom associated with rare, systemic adverse reactions involving the blood, such as leukopenia (a low white blood cell count). This effect is considered associated with the sulfonamide component of the drug.


Q: Can Bactrazine be taken with a common pain reliever like ibuprofen?

Regulatory patient guidance emphasizes the importance of informing the healthcare provider about all prescription and nonprescription medications being taken, including common pain relievers like ibuprofen. This is because systemic absorption of the sulfadiazine component may occur, which could necessitate monitoring or dose adjustments for co-administered drugs.


Q: Can you still drive or operate machinery while taking Bactrazine?

While the cream is a topical treatment, the safety profile notes that rare systemic side effects, such as unusual weakness or dizziness, may occur. These symptoms could potentially affect the ability to drive or operate machinery, and are the types of symptoms that healthcare providers would want to know about.


Q: Does Bactrazine interact with supplements like Vitamin D or iron?

Official regulatory guidance suggests providing the healthcare provider with a complete list of all vitamins, nutritional supplements, and herbal products being taken. This allows the provider to assess the potential for any indirect interactions or the need to monitor for side effects.


Q: Are there official warnings about taking Bactrazine with alcohol?

Regulatory patient guidance suggests that individuals discuss the use of the medicine with alcohol and other substances, like food or tobacco, with a healthcare professional. This is recommended because potential interactions may occur depending on the extent of systemic drug absorption.


Q: Can Bactrazine cause dizziness?

Official product information notes that dizziness is a possible symptom of an infrequent, systemic adverse reaction related to the blood. This symptom is one that healthcare providers typically consider important to monitor, as it may be linked to low blood cell levels.


Q: Why do some sources warn about combining Bactrazine with certain heart medications?

The sulfadiazine component of the cream has the potential to increase the effect of certain other medications, such as some anticoagulants (medicines used to prevent blood clots). Regulatory information notes that co-administration with these drugs is typically managed with careful clinical monitoring.


Q: Does Bactrazine affect fertility?

Regulatory labeling includes a section for information on the impairment of fertility, but specific human data on this topic are limited. Official animal reproductive studies performed showed no evidence that the drug impaired the ability to conceive.


Q: Why is Bactrazine sometimes mentioned with sun sensitivity?

Official sources state that the drug can cause an increased sensitivity of the treated skin to sunlight (a reaction known as photosensitivity). This effect is of particular note when the cream is applied to large body surface areas.


Q: Why do people sometimes need to take a second course of Bactrazine?

Official regulatory requirements state that the treatment should continue until the wound has satisfactorily healed or is ready for a skin graft, and it should not be withdrawn while there is a possibility of infection. The need to start a 'second course' could arise if an infection recurs or persists after a period of treatment cessation.


Q: Are there any specific laboratory tests required before starting Bactrazine?

Regulatory guidance indicates that in patients with extensive burns, it is standard practice for healthcare providers to monitor serum sulfa concentrations and white blood cell counts, given the potential risk of leukopenia (low white blood cell count). Monitoring of renal (kidney) function is also generally part of clinical management.


Q: Can Bactrazine be used by people who are lactose intolerant?

The inactive ingredients detailed in the official regulatory description of the cream typically do not include lactose. However, for individuals with a known intolerance, confirmation of all excipients on the specific product's labeling is usually done by a healthcare professional.


Q: How long does Bactrazine stay in the body after the last dose?

The active component is primarily eliminated from the body by the kidneys. Official pharmacological information indicates that the absorbed sulfonamide component has an elimination half-life of approximately 10 hours.


Q: Why is Bactrazine a prescription-only medicine?

Bactrazine is classified as a prescription-only (Rx) medicine because its use requires professional oversight. Official regulatory bodies classify the product as prescription-only due to factors such as the potential risk of serious systemic side effects and the necessary clinical monitoring, which may include checking blood cell counts.

How should Bactrazine be stored and disposed of?

How to Store and Dispose of Bactrazine (Silver Sulfadiazine Cream)

Official labeling defines strict conditions for storing Bactrazine to maintain its effectiveness and safety.


Storage Requirements

Condition Regulatory Rule
Temperature Store at Controlled Room Temperature, typically 15 C to 30 C (59 F to 86 F).
Protection Keep from freezing and protect from light and excessive heat and moisture.
Container Keep in the original container and ensure it is tightly closed when not in use.
Safety The product must be stored out of the sight and reach of children.

Disposal Instructions

Disposal of unused or expired cream must follow local disposal regulations, such as using a drug take-back program. It should not be flushed down the toilet or poured into a drain unless specifically instructed by local authorities. If placed in household trash, unused cream should be mixed with an undesirable substance like coffee grounds and sealed.
